在我的 ionic 2 应用程序中,我想在 android studio 上发送应用程序。
当我在终端ionic emulate -l -s android
上运行此命令时出现此错误:
错误:找不到模块'./version'
这是我终端上的输出:
watch failed: watcher error:
/home/user/Workspace/ionic-app/home/user/Workspace/ionic-app/src/assets/**/*,/home/user/Workspace/ionic-app/src/index.html,/home/user/Workspace/ionic-app/src/manifest.json,/home/user/Workspace/ionic-app/src/service-worker.js,/home/user/Workspace/ionic-app/node_modules/ionicons/dist/fonts/**/*,/home/user/Workspace/ionic-app/node_modules/ionic-angular/fonts/**/*,/home/user/Workspace/ionic-app/node_modules/ionic-angular/polyfills/polyfills.js,/home/user/Workspace/ionic-app/node_modules/sw-toolbox/sw-toolbox.js:
Error: watch
/home/user/Workspace/ionic-app/node_modules/ionicons/dist/fonts ENOSPC
dev server running: http://192.168.0.149:8101/
Error: Cannot find module './version'
我不明白我错在哪里。为什么会出现此错误以及此./version
模块是什么?
答案 0 :(得分:0)
我找到了解决方案。在我的项目开发期间,有一个更新的android studio(sdk管理器,sdk工具,gradle等)。
我必须删除文件夹ionic-app/platforms/android
,然后通过使用gradle导入离子应用程序,通过android studio重新构建应用程序。